PowerMill 2020 is an industry-leading CAM software designed for high-speed and 5-axis machining. This comprehensive guide outlines the foundational and advanced workflows found in the official PowerMill training manuals 2020 feature documentation 1. Getting Started: Initial Setup

Before calculating toolpaths, the environment must be correctly configured to ensure accuracy and safety. Importing Models : Launch PowerMill 2020 and import your STEP or IGES files. Workplane Definition : Create and activate a workplane to establish the orientation for machining. Stock Block (Material)

: Define the material block from which the part will be cut. This can be a standard rectangular block or a custom shape. Tool Creation

: Define specific cutting tools (e.g., 20mm End Mill) and set parameters like Cutting Speed (90–120 m/min) and (400–600 mm/min) based on the material. 2. Machining Strategies

PowerMill 2020 excels at high-efficiency strategies that reduce machining time. Roughing Operations

The primary goal is rapid material removal while leaving a specified "thickness" for finishing. Model Area Clearance : The standard roughing strategy. : Recommended at 50% of the tool diameter. Rest Roughing

: Use smaller cutters to remove material left behind by larger tools in previous passes. Finishing Strategies These create the final surface quality of the part. Constant Z : Ideal for steep walls. Steep and Shallow powermill 2020 tutorial pdf exclusive

: A hybrid strategy that automatically applies different toolpaths to steep vs. shallow areas for a uniform finish.

: Maintains a consistent stepover across the entire model surface. 3. Key Enhancements in PowerMill 2020

The 2020 version introduced significant speed and usability improvements: Processing Speed : Common toolpaths like Raster and Constant Z can be up to 67% faster than the 2019 version. Simulation & Verification

: ViewMill simulations and NC program verifications are up to 33% faster Collision Avoidance

: Boundaries calculated within a setup now account for toolpath clamp settings to prevent collisions. High DPI Support : Enhanced icons for 4K monitors. 4. Simulation and NC Export
